This home is situated on Cavendish Road, within the exclusive private estate of St George’s Hill. A beautifully presented detached, single-storey lodge house, it has been thoughtfully designed with neutral décor and high-quality finishes, perfectly suited to contemporary family living.
The front door opens into an impressive double-height entrance hall featuring parquet style porcelain flooring and a striking limed oak beam. Double doors lead into the stunning open-plan kitchen/living space, fitted with quartz worktops and premium integrated appliances, including a Siemens oven and induction hob, and a Fisher & Paykel American style fridge freezer. The fittings are finished in an elegant lacquered antique brass.
A David Salisbury orangery enhances the space, with a large skylight, statement pendant lanterns, and French doors opening onto the patio, flooding the room with natural light and creating an ideal indoor/outdoor entertaining area. A separate utility room offers further practicality, complete with a double sink, Miele washing machine and dryer, and ample storage. To the right of the hallway are two double bedrooms, one overlooking the rear garden with fitted wardrobes, served by a luxurious family bathroom. To the left lies the principal suite, enjoying views over the beautifully maintained garden, extensive built-in storage, and a stylish ensuite with dual sinks, a freestanding bath, and a separate shower. A further bedroom at the front of the property is also located on this side, with access to an additional shower room.
The garden is predominantly laid to lawn, bordered by mature trees and shrubs for privacy. A large patio area leads to landscaped grounds, including a charming woodland walkway with attractive planting. To the front, a shingle driveway is complemented by flower beds, with paved access to the entrance. The property further benefits from a garage and parking for multiple vehicles.
Location
St George’s Hill is internationally renowned as one of the most sought-after private estates in England. Access onto the private, gated estate is controlled 24 hours a day by the estate’s security personnel and is restricted at all times. St George’s Hill is set in some 900 acres and features a private championship standard golf course and a separate private tennis and squash club. The tennis club is one of the foremost racquet sports clubs in England, with 30 grass and all-weather tennis courts, two indoor courts and four squash courts. The tennis club also has a 20 metre indoor swimming pool, a well-equipped gym and a restaurant and bar.
St George’s Hill offers an ideal location for families looking for security and privacy and there are several English and International schools in the area including Reeds School, St George’s College and The ACS International School at Cobham. Weybridge and the surrounding area has a variety of primary and senior schools in both the private and public sectors, providing education from nursery through to 6th form and also a very popular 6th form college.
Located on the South bank of the rivers Thames and Wey where the two rivers meet, Weybridge is an historic town that dates back to the Iron Age. Originally named after the wooden bridge over the river Wey used by pilgrims to the Chertsey Abbey, in the last 100 years Weybridge has become known for its aspirational, innovative and creative residents. Each generation leaving their legacy to the town through its own style of properties and industry.
There was once a royal palace in Weybridge that was used by Henry VIII and his wives, as well as other Kings and Queens. Today, Oatlands Park Hotel is all that remains of the royal estate. You can still find reminders of the original palace in and around Weybridge.
In more recent history, Weybridge was a magnet for motor enthusiasts, as it was home to Brooklands Race Track, some of the track still remains.Today you can visit Brooklands Museum and Mercedes Benz World at the site.
